Among the different types of skin cancer, melanoma is considered to be the
deadliest and is difficult to treat at advanced stages. Detection of melanoma
at earlier stages can lead to reduced mortality rates. Desktop-based
computer-aided systems have been developed to assist dermatologists with early
diagnosis. However, there is significant interest in developing portable,
at-home melanoma diagnostic systems which can assess the risk of cancerous skin
lesions. Here, we present a smartphone application that combines image capture
